What is an O-Ring Socket?

An O-ring socket is a fitting designed to house an O-ring, which is a loop of elastomer with a round cross-section. The primary purpose of an O-ring is to provide a seal between two parts to prevent the passage of fluids or gases.

Types of O-Ring Sockets

O-ring sockets come in various sizes and materials to suit different applications. Common types include:

  • Standard O-Ring Sockets: Used in general applications with standard-sized O-rings.
  • Metric O-Ring Sockets: Designed for O-rings that follow metric measurements.
  • Custom O-Ring Sockets: Tailored for specific applications with unique requirements.

Materials

O-ring sockets and O-rings themselves can be made from different materials, including:

  • Nitrile Rubber (NBR): Ideal for oil and fuel applications.
  • Fluoroelastomer (Viton): Suitable for high-temperature and chemical-resistant applications.
  • Silicone: Used in high and low-temperature applications, suitable for food and medical industries.
  • EPDM: Commonly used in water and steam applications.

Installation of O-Ring Sockets

Proper installation of O-ring sockets is crucial to ensure a reliable seal. Follow these steps for successful installation:

1. Prepare the Components

  • Clean the Surfaces: Ensure that all surfaces where the O-ring and socket will contact are clean and free from debris, dirt, and oil.
  • Inspect the O-Ring: Check the O-ring for any damage or defects. A damaged O-ring should be replaced immediately.

2. Lubricate the O-Ring

  • Use a compatible lubricant to lightly coat the O-ring. This helps in reducing friction during installation and extends the life of the O-ring.

3. Place the O-Ring in the Socket

  • Carefully position the O-ring in the socket groove, ensuring it sits evenly without twists or kinks.

4. Assemble the Components

  • Align the components and press them together gently, ensuring the O-ring remains seated properly. Avoid using excessive force which can damage the O-ring.

Maintenance of O-Ring Sockets

Regular maintenance of O-ring sockets helps in prolonging their lifespan and ensuring a reliable seal. Here are some maintenance tips:

Regular Inspections

  • Check for Wear and Tear: Regularly inspect the O-rings for signs of wear, cracks, or deformation.
  • Monitor Seals: Ensure that seals remain intact and there is no leakage.

Cleaning

  • Clean the O-ring and socket surfaces periodically to prevent the build-up of debris and contaminants.

Replacement

  • Replace O-rings periodically based on the manufacturer's recommendations or when any signs of damage are detected.

Troubleshooting Common Issues

Leaks

  • Cause: Improper installation, damaged O-ring, or incompatible materials.
  • Solution: Reinstall the O-ring ensuring it is properly seated, replace damaged O-rings, and ensure material compatibility.

Excessive Wear

  • Cause: High friction, improper lubrication, or abrasive contaminants.
  • Solution: Use appropriate lubricants, check for and remove contaminants, and consider using O-rings made from more durable materials.

O-Ring Deformation

  • Cause: Overcompression or exposure to incompatible chemicals.
  • Solution: Follow proper installation procedures to avoid overcompression and ensure chemical compatibility.
